ABOUT UMBILICOPLASTY TURKEY
For umbilicoplasty in Turkey hospitals apart from improving the person appearance, Umbilicoplasty surgery is usually done using local anesthesia together with sedative to make the patient feel drowsy so the patient is kept awake but not feeling any discomfort. The surgery usually takes an hour to perform unless there are other surgeries done with it. Different techniques are used to perform the surgery depending on the new shape desired by the patient. The surgeon will make incisions inside the belly button to make scars less visible. A light dressing may be applied after the surgery but there is no need for drainage tubes. Stitches used are usually dissolvable so there is no need for them to be removed.

AFTER UMBILICOPLASTY
- Patients must keep hydrated for a faster recovery.
- Patients must use prescribed medication correctly and on time.
- Patients are usually sent home a few hours after the surgery as it is done on an outpatient basis.
- Recovery will take a week after the surgery but patients can return to their normal activities after a day or two from the surgery.

RISK OF UMBILICOPLASTY SURGERY
There is chance of complications occurring in every surgery. In Umbilicoplasty surgery there is a chance of such complications occurring as;
- Bleeding.
- Infection.
- Bruising.
- Reaction to anesthesia.
- Numbness.
